Maintaining the right humidity indoors is essential for health and comfort, especially during dry seasons or in air-conditioned spaces. Many people wonder: cool mist or warm mist humidifier? Knowing the differences, benefits, and drawbacks of each will help you pick the best option.
Cool mist humidifiers release a fine, room-temperature mist into the air. There are mainly two types: ultrasonic and evaporative.
Ultrasonic humidifiers use vibrations to generate mist.
Evaporative humidifiers use a wick filter and fan to evaporate water.
Advantages:
Safe for children and pets since no heating is involved, reducing burn risk.
The cool mist feels refreshing, ideal for warmer months or climates.
Usually energy-efficient with low power consumption.
Limitations:
If not cleaned regularly, may disperse bacteria or mold spores, potentially affecting air quality.
Some evaporative models may produce slight fan noise during operation.
Warm mist humidifiers boil water to create steam, which cools slightly before being released.
Advantages:
The boiling process kills most bacteria and mold, producing a cleaner mist.
Provides effective and fast humidification, especially soothing in cold seasons.
Adds slight warmth to the room, enhancing comfort in winter.
Limitations:
The hot steam poses a burn risk, so caution is needed around children.
Consumes more electricity due to the heating element.
Requires regular cleaning to prevent mineral buildup from boiling water.
Safety: Cool mist humidifiers are safer for households with children and pets as they don’t use heat. Warm mist humidifiers carry a burn risk because of the hot steam.
Humidification & Comfort: Warm mist humidifiers provide quicker, warmer humidity suitable for cold environments. Cool mist units offer gentle, refreshing moisture, ideal for warmer months.
Maintenance: Cool mist models require frequent cleaning to prevent bacteria and mold growth. Warm mist units need descaling to remove mineral deposits.
Energy Consumption & Noise: Cool mist humidifiers, especially ultrasonic types, tend to use less energy and operate quietly. Warm mist humidifiers use more electricity and might produce boiling sounds.

When picking a humidifier, consider these factors:
Climate and Season: Warm mist humidifiers are ideal for cold, dry winters; cool mist works well in warmer conditions or all year.
Safety: Cool mist or 2-in-1 models are better for homes with children or pets.
Maintenance Commitment: Regular cleaning is essential to prevent bacteria and mineral buildup in both types.
Energy Use and Noise: Ultrasonic cool mist models are typically quieter and consume less power.
